What is it?
Mimuro Monaka fills a crisp round wafer stamped with a stylized cedar motif with smooth, richly flavored azuki paste.
History and local context
The long-established Sakurai confection takes its name from Mount Miwa, also called Mimuro, linking the sweet with the sacred landscape and old roads of Yamato.
How to enjoy it
Eat the official monaka with green tea and follow the package date before the wafer absorbs moisture from the filling.
